Synopsis
Kingdom of Fear: Loathsome Secrets of a Star-Crossed Child in the Final Days of the American Century is a memoir by Hunter S. Thompson, a collection of parables and his outlandish adventures. We learn more about his run-ins with authority, his time in the Air Force, and the beginning of his Gonzo journalistic career. Thompson shares insights on his unsuccessful bid for Sheriff of Aspen, Colorado in 1970, and comments on the problems caused by the ineffectual War on Terror. "The prevailing quality of life in America--by any accepted methods of measuring--was inarguably freer and more politically open under Nixon than it is today in this evil year of Our Lord 2002."
